> I popped in a Sierra Generations Family Tree Deluxe CD and ran its setup
> program. A small window titled "Setup" appears with a gas gauge and the
> text "Generations(R) 4.2 Setup is preparing the InstallShield(R) Wizard
> which will guide you through the rest of the setup process. Please
> wait.". The gauge goes up to 100%, a Sierra splash screen appears, and
> then a dialog box with no title, no contents, a white X on a red circle,
> and an OK button. There's a little icon on the title bar's left side
> that looks like a martini glass with a cherry in it to me.
>
> The program exits after hitting OK.
Robert, I had the same issue when my locale was configured to output
Russian messages.
The dialogs were with text after I set up environment variable:
LC_MESSAGES
(in /etc/sysconfig/i18n for RedHad 7.1)
What locale do you have set up?
What is your operation system?
